CVE-2023-52085 is a Local File Inclusion (LFI) vulnerability affecting Winter CMS versions prior to v1.2.4. It allows authenticated backend users with ColorPicker FormWidget access to inject malicious values into custom stylesheets, potentially leading to the inclusion of local files. Rated Medium severity with a CVSS score of 5.4, this vulnerability requires low privileges and low attack complexity, but only results in limited confidentiality and integrity impact. While there is no evidence of active exploitation, a Nuclei template exists for detection, and there is minimal community discussion or media coverage surrounding this CVE.
